Fan-out backpressure for the Quillet notifier: when the queue depth crosses the soft limit, the dispatcher sheds low-priority pushes and batches the rest at 500ms intervals. Reviewer should confirm the shed counter is exported and that retries respect the jitter window. Once merged, the release artifact gets re-signed by the pipeline, which expects the deploy key shown below.

deploy key for bawep-yawif: bky6_GQhaSt

## Runbook: Sensor drift — Greenloft controller

If humidity readings drift more than 5% from the reference probe, recalibrate via `greenloft cal --zone`. Log the offset in the shift sheet. Drift recurring within 24h means a failing probe; flag it, don't recalibrate again. Historical calibration records live in the telemetry database, reachable with the following.

primary connection of yagep-kahip = redis://giliel_svc:zYiKsLL2PLpfPL@db-348f.xolmarsys.corp:5432/fenwyn

### Changed defaults

Heads up, plugin folks: Graphloom 3.2 flips the default layout engine from radial to layered, and lazy edge loading is now on out of the box. If your plugin assumed eager edges, you'll want to opt back in explicitly. The new shipped defaults that every fresh install picks up are reproduced below for reference.

deployment values, yadug-bawif:
[framir]
team = pelox
access_code = ac_a38ab2
owner = tamion.julael
host = framir.tolvaqlabs.test
port = 11211
peer = tammir.zemvargrid.local
salt = 2215ef03
pin = 1541

Changelog — SproutCycle v2.3: Heads up, we renamed WATER_TOKEN to SCHEDULER_API_SECRET because folks kept confusing it with the moisture-sensor token. Same value, new name, old one stops working next release. If you're setting up a fresh env file for the scheduler, just drop the renamed line in right after this note:

vault entry, bagep-yahip: VAULT_KEY8=d2a227e5

// REINDEX_BATCH_CAP limits docs per shard pass in the Tallowfield
// nightly search reindex. Raising it starves the ingest queue;
// lowering it overruns the maintenance window. 5000 is the tested
// sweet spot. Change only with a soak run. Verified against the
// build noted below.

session token of bawif-hahog = htk6_ac5981